#b59c1e basic color information

#b59c1e

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#b59c1e has decimal index of: 11901982, is composed of 71% red, 61.2% green and 11.8% blue. #b59c1e in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 13.8% magenta, 83.4% yellow and 29% black.
#cc9933 is the closest web-safe color to #b59c1e.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
